The case for & against
Bull & Bear analysis
The Travelers Companies, Inc. (NYSE: TRV) is a leading player in the property and casualty insurance sector, serving a diverse range of customers, including individuals and businesses. The company features a robust portfolio encompassing commercial and personal insurance products, placing it strategically within the insurance value chain as it integrates innovative technologies like AI to enhance underwriting practices and customer engagement. As a participant in the evolving digital insurance landscape, TRV is positioned to capture revenue streams through advancements in technology and proactive pricing strategies.
Bull says
- ↑Q1 EPS $7.71 beat by $0.91; P/E 10.05x suggests undervaluation
- ↑Revenue $11.92B in Q1 topped estimates; high earnings yield
- ↑Institutional ownership 82.5%; Diversify Wealth raised stake 995% in Q1
- ↑Selected as anchor carrier for Applied Systems’ new AI insurance platform
- ↑Quarterly dividend $1.25 (yield ~10.7%); strong cash flows support payouts
- ↑Low price volatility and favorable book-to-price ratio hint at upside
Bear says
- ↓Q2 EPS expected $5.14, down 18% YoY, signaling slowing earnings
- ↓Negative growth outlook amid forecasted EPS decline and downward revisions
- ↓Insider selling $12.8M and rising short interest raise caution
- ↓Severe-weather catastrophe losses may hike combined ratios, eroding margins
- ↓Negative revision and balance-sheet quality indicators suggest financial strain
- ↓Analysts see ~5% overvaluation amid market pressures and competition
